Beskrivelse
Summary:The book presents and discusses two major energy systemsthat make the Earth a dynamic planet: one is a hydrologic system, the circulation of waterover the Earth's surface, which involves the movement of water in the ocean, rivers, underground, and in glaciers. The other is the tectonic system, the movement of material powered by heat from the Earth's interior. This system involves the evolution of continents and ocean basins, and mountain-building
